In the few days that Drageda had claimed the cliffs it already appeared their numbers were steadily growing. More wolves had joined in these few days than the whole time he had been at the mountain. He figured outsiders were looking for a place to lounge during the winter and therefore had joined the ranks in hopes of scraping by. But if that was their true intention they would not be greeted kindly by the gray furred man. His poor attitude towards those not of Seageda or Trigeda had not changed, but he was beginning to understand the differences of their lives from his. 

News of Seregryn joining them had reached his ears and Tanja was rather interested in the matter. The Fos Goufa had always appeared to have a hunger for power back in Trigeda and he wondered if she had changed in the time he was gone, though he highly doubted it. She was being groomed to take over when Heda fell and the responsibility of that was like none other. 

But that was of little concern to him at the moment as he was preparing to go on yet another patrol. However he caught a glimpse of a silhouette hanging in the distance of the dimly lit cavern and decided to go check who it was. As he approached, it became easy to recognize who lie ahead and Tanja let his tail swish happily behind him as drew near to Heda. He feared the sudden abandonment of the mountain and the travel had caused her to become stressed, but he wished for her to know that he was pleased with her decision of staying here. "I like it here. It reminds me of Seageda" he finally called out while the distance between the two slowly closed.
